Optimizing for Conversational Queries

Given that voice searches are inherently more conversational, content must be optimized to answer questions directly and succinctly. Incorporating natural language with a focus on long-tail keywords has become more important than ever.

Content that directly answers the who, what, when, where, why, and how questions can significantly improve its visibility in voice searches. Moreover, featured snippets in search results have become a prime target for voice search optimization, as these are frequently used to answer voice queries.

Adapting content to match this conversational tone can enhance user engagement and improve the chances of being featured in voice search results.

The Significance of Local Search

Local search is intrinsically linked with voice search. Many users rely on voice commands to find local businesses, products, or services. Therefore, optimizing for local SEO has become critical.

Ensuring your business information is correct and comprehensively listed across online directories and platforms like Google My Business can significantly boost local visibility.

Incorporating locality-specific keywords into your SEO strategy is also paramount to capturing the attention of voice search users.

Positive reviews and an active online presence can further elevate your ranking in local search queries, making your business more accessible through voice search.
